| Category | Specification | | :--- | :--- | | | Dell VJ4YX Rev A00 | | Chipset | Intel Q87 Express (Supports vPro, AMT 9.0) | | CPU Socket | LGA 1150 | | Supported Processors | Intel Core i7-4770 / i7-4790, i5-4570 / i5-4590 / i5-4670, i3-4130 / i3-4150 / i3-4170, Pentium G3220 / G3250, Celeron G1820 / G1840 | | Memory Type | DDR3 (Non-ECC, Unbuffered) | | Memory Slots | 2 x DIMM (240-pin) | | Max Memory Support | 16GB (2 x 8GB) | | Memory Speed | 1333MHz or 1600MHz (downclocked to CPU support) | | Expansion Slots | 1 x PCIe x16 (v2.0), 1 x PCIe x1 (v2.0), 1 x Half-Length Mini PCIe (for Wi-Fi/BT) | | Storage Interfaces | 2 x SATA 3.0 (6Gb/s), 1 x SATA 2.0 (3Gb/s) | | M.2 Slot | No | | Rear I/O | 1 x VGA, 1 x DisplayPort, 2 x USB 3.0, 4 x USB 2.0, 1 x RJ-45 Gigabit LAN, 2 x Audio jacks (Line-out/Mic-in), 1 x PS/2 Keyboard, 1 x PS/2 Mouse | | Front Panel Header | Dell Proprietary 16-pin connector (power switch, LED, HDD LED, reset) | | Audio Codec | Realtek ALC3220 (High Definition Audio) | | LAN Controller | Intel I217-LM (Gigabit Ethernet, supports vPro) | | TPM Header | Yes (Trusted Platform Module 1.2/2.0 ready) | | Power Connector | Standard 24-pin ATX (proprietary pinout possible – check) + 4-pin CPU | | BIOS | UEFI with Legacy ROM support, Dell BIOS version Axx (A12/A16/A18 common) | | Form Factor | Dell SFF (Small Form Factor) – proprietary |
